Hyrum, Cache County, Utah Population and Demographics

In this article, we'll explore the population statistics for Hyrum, Utah, including popular demographics data like median age, number of households, household income, gender, employment and unemployment rates, occupations, religion, and more.

We are using the latest American Community Survey (ACS) 5-Year survey data from the US Census Bureau, which is accurate up to 2021.

Population

There is a lot of data that lets us see how many people live in Hyrum, Utah. The most basic data is the total population, which is the total number of people living in Hyrum, Utah. The estimated population of Hyrum, Utah is 9,330 people, with a median age of 28.5.

Median Household Income

The latest median household income of Hyrum, Utah is $73,971.00.

In simple terms, the median income is the middle income of a group of people. Half of the people in the group make more than the median income, and half make less. The median income is a good indicator of the overall income of a group of people, and can be used to compare against other metrics such as the average income, per capita income, and more.

Average Household Income

Whenever we ask what is the average household income in Hyrum, we are actually talking about the mean household income.

This is calculated by adding up all the incomes of all the households in Hyrum, and then dividing that number by the total number of households. This is a good way to get a general idea of the average income of a group of people, but it can be skewed by a very high or very low incomes.

The average household income of Hyrum, Utah is currently $81,921.00.

In terms of accurately summarizing income at a geographic level, the median income is a better metric than the average income because it isn't affected by a small number of very high or very low incomes.

If you had an area where the average income was greater than the median, it can mean that there is significant income inequality, with income being concentrated in a small number of wealthy households.

2.82% of households in Hyrum are classed as high income households (making $200,000+ per year).

Per Capita Income

The per capita income in Hyrum is $23,616.00.

Per capita income is the average income of a person in a given area. It is calculated by dividing the total income of Hyrum by the total population of Hyrum.

This is different from the average or mean income because it includes and accounts for all people in Hyrum, Utah, including people like children, the elderly, unemployed people, retired people, and more.

Employment

Employment rates are all based around the total population in Hyrum that are over the age of 16.

The total population of Hyrum over the age of 16 is 6,462.

Of those people, a total of 66.80% are working or actively looking for work. This is called the labor force participation rate.

The participation rate is a useful market measure because it shows the relative amount of labor resources available to the economy.

The employment to total population rate in Hyrum is 64.90%.

Occupations

In this section we can look at the most common occupations in Hyrum as well as the gender breakdown and earnings of them.

The total population of civilian employees that are 16 years old or older in Hyrum is 4,194, with median earnings of $34,334.00.

Women in Hyrum, Utah earning approximately 70.20% of the men's earnings.

Population Earnings
Total 4,194 $34,334.00
Male 2,454 $39,483.00
Female 1,740 $27,725.00

Households and Family Size

A household defined bu the US Census Bureau is a group of people who occupy a housing unit. A housing unit is a house, apartment, mobile home, group of rooms, or single room occupied as separate living quarters.

There are currently 2,656 households in Hyrum, with an average household size of 3.51 people.

A family is defined as a group of two or more people related by birth, marriage, or adoption who live together in the same household.

There are 2,320 families in Hyrum with an average family size of 3.8 people.

Housing

There are 2,704 housing units in Hyrum, Utah.

The table below shows the split between occupied and vacant units:

Total Percentage
Occupied 2,656 98.22%
Vacant 48 1.78%

17.27% of the total 2,704 housing units in Hyrum are rental units. This is approximately 467 properties.

For owner-occupied housing units, a total of 2,183 are occupied by the owner - or 80.73% of the total.

Rental Rates

The median rent for a property in Hyrum is $832.00.
